Reds Racing Durabell clutch bell

Reds Racing Durabell clutch bell

Reds Racing have introduced the Durabell 1/8th off-road competition clutch bell. Made of high quality steel and sporting a special coating treatment the teeth last longer compared to standard clutch bells, making for greater consistency and reliability. A special vented design also guarantees lower temperatures and improved clutch shoe engagement for a longer life of both the bell and clutch shoes. The Durabell is available in 13 and 14 teeth version only and it is suitable for Kyosho, Mugen, JQ, Xray, Associated, Hot Bodies, Serpent, and Xray but it does not replace Reds Racing’s standard 13 and 14 teeth clutch bells.

Exotek TLR22 3.0 battery post & twist nut set

Exotek TLR22 3.0 battery post & twist nut set

Exotek have introduced a battery post and twist nut set for the TLR22 3.0 buggy. The lightweight and secure design does away with the stock body clip system with the set including two machined aluminium posts, two knurled twist nuts as well as mini rubber O-rings that stop the twist nuts when tightened them down, to prevent the nuts from accidentally loosening.

Kyosho Optima 4WD buggy re-release

Kyosho Optima 4WD buggy re-release

Following a first teaser Kyosho have now officially introduced the Kyosho Optima 4WD buggy re-release. Redesigned by the original designer, the Optima has been carefully redeveloped from ground up to bring back the best of the buggies in the good old days and to offer a true fun to drive feel. The “2016” Optima is designed based on the original version released in the 1980’s, it features several updated areas without compromising parts compatibility with the original chassis. The upgrades and updates include 6061-T6 aluminium chassis material, the drivetrain can be build with the original chain or and optional belt drive, the diff gears are ball-raced, all gears are modern 48 pitch gears, and a slipper clutch allows the use of more powerful motors. The tyres offer a slightly modified tread and they are made using softer rubber and included in the kit is also all-hex hardware as well as two different front bumpers.

Arrowmax 64 grade titanium M3 & M4 screws

Arrowmax 64 grade titanium M3 & M4 screws

Coming from Arrowmax is a range of 64 grade titanium M3 and M4 screws. The fully CNC-machined fasteners come with Arrowmax’ AM logo engraved and they are available in a range of sizes including M3x5 to M3x18 as well as M4x8 to M4x12 in both countersunk or button head design. The screws are available in packs of five and due to being made of a very lightweight material they can help to lower the overall weight of car significantly.
